欢迎来到天天文库
浏览记录
ID:29850886
大小:21.37 KB
页数:11页
时间:2018-12-24
《中南民族大学windows编程实验报告》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、为了适应公司新战略的发展,保障停车场安保新项目的正常、顺利开展,特制定安保从业人员的业务技能及个人素质的培训计划中南民族大学windows编程实验报告 院系:**********学院专业:********年级:20**级课程名称:组号:组组员:指导教师: XX年01月 院系:计算机科学学院专业:计算机科学与技术年级:XX级课程名称:windows编程组员:蓝森智辛金良李龙龙指导教师:程鹏 XX年10月20日 框架代码文件主要由 1应用程序类CxxxxApp 2对话框类CxxxxDlg
2、继承CDialog类负责与用户的交互,处理用户消息,接受用户的输入。3资源文件定义资源ID 4预编译文件可以用来解决头文件包含冲突的问题,定义了一些需要全局性包含的文件。应用程序基类CWinApp 所谓头文件预编译,就是把一个工程(Project)中使用的一些MFC标准头文件(如、)预先编译,以后该工程编译时,不再编译这部分头文件,仅仅使用预编译的结果。编译结果文件是 编译器认为,所有在指令#include""前的代码都是预编译的,它跳过#include"stdafx.h"指令,使用编译这条
3、指令之后的所有代码。目的-通过该培训员工可对保安行业有初步了解,并感受到安保行业的发展的巨大潜力,可提升其的专业水平,并确保其在这个行业的安全感。为了适应公司新战略的发展,保障停车场安保新项目的正常、顺利开展,特制定安保从业人员的业务技能及个人素质的培训计划 Windows是建立在消息驱动机制上的,模态对话框正是利用对Windows消息的特殊处理方式,才实现了其特有的效果。 非模态对话框不会垄断用户的输入,用户仍然可以使用其他的窗口。 属性对话框把多个独立的对话框有效合理地组织起来的一种结构
4、。 按钮控件包含以下四种基本类型: 1.下压按钮;2.复选按钮;3.单选按钮;4.自绘按钮 焦点是当前活动的控件或窗口,用TAB可以切换焦点 编辑框CEdit类 列表框CListBox类 组合框CComboxBox类 组合框可以看作一个编辑控件或静态控件与一个列表框的组合。 1s=1000ms 文档类CDocument负责维护应用程序所需要的数据,提供一系列可对这些数据进行操作的方法,并且能够为视图提供所需要的数据。 视图类CView拥有窗口的客户区域,负责显示文档数据,接受用
5、户输入,提供文档与用户通信。目的-通过该培训员工可对保安行业有初步了解,并感受到安保行业的发展的巨大潜力,可提升其的专业水平,并确保其在这个行业的安全感。为了适应公司新战略的发展,保障停车场安保新项目的正常、顺利开展,特制定安保从业人员的业务技能及个人素质的培训计划 一个文档可对应多个视图;但一个视图只能对应一个唯一的文档。 htm文件是文档,记事本和浏览器就是这个文档的两个视图。 文档与视图的结构的优势:数据的管理与现实的分离 根据不同的需求以不同的形式呈现,这就是视图特性。 在使用文
6、档/视图体系开发应用程序过程时,涉及四个部分:文档模板;文档;视图;框架窗口 MFC的CView类是所有视图类的基类,主要有两大功能:1.将与其相关联文档的数据呈现给用户;2.接受用户对数据的修改,并反馈给文档 文档负责数据的管理; 视图负责数据的显示; 框架窗口负责管理这些界面 单文档窗口SDI——同时最多只能打开一个框架窗口; 多文档窗口MDI——对打开框架窗口的个数没有限制。 图形设备接口(GraphicsDeviceInterface,GDI)是把应用程序的函数调用传递给图形
7、设备驱动程序,由设备驱动程序来执行与硬件相关的函数。 在MFC中使用GDI进行绘图操作一般会涉及两类对象:目的-通过该培训员工可对保安行业有初步了解,并感受到安保行业的发展的巨大潜力,可提升其的专业水平,并确保其在这个行业的安全感。为了适应公司新战略的发展,保障停车场安保新项目的正常、顺利开展,特制定安保从业人员的业务技能及个人素质的培训计划 1.设备上下(来自:写论文网:中南民族大学windows编程实验报告)文对象(DeviceContext,DC),包括CDC及其派生类;利用该对象可以实
8、现向屏幕、打印机和图元文件的输出。 对象(GraphicsDeviceInterface,GDI),包括CFont,CBrush,CPen等 画刷是一个像素大小为8*8的位图,用对个相同的位图对封闭图形的内部进行填充 键盘上的每一个键都对应一个唯一的扫描码,并在按下或释放时产生通知。 扫描码是设备相 关的。在Windows系统中为实现设备无关的要求,需要使用虚拟键值,定义一组与设备无关的标示符。 一般情况下,处理键盘消息就是根据不同的虚拟键值来识别不同的按键状态。 在
此文档下载收益归作者所有